Brahmastra Part One Shiva Review: Spectacular Visual Effects Raise the Bar for Bollywood Movies

Brahmastra Part One Shiva is a fantasy adventure film theatrically released on 9th September 2022. It is written and directed by Ayan Mukerji, and produced by Dharma Productions, Starlight Pictures, and Prime Focus in association with Star Studios, along with Ranbir Kapoor and Marijke DeSouza.

It has a runtime of about 2 hours and 40 minutes in total. The cast of the film includes Amitabh Bachchan as Guru, the leader of the Brahmansh, Ranbir Kapoor as Shiva, Alia Bhatt as Isha, Mouni Roy as Junoon, Nagarjuna Akkineni as Anish Shetty, Dimple Kapadia, Saurav Gurjar and Gurfateh Pirzada.

This is the story of Shiva who sets out in search of love and self-discovery. During his journey, he has to face many evil forces that threaten our existence. The world we live in has many superhumans who possess the power of unique astras which were born from the Brahm-Shakti.

They derive from elements in the natural world like Jal (water) Astra, Pawan (wind) Astra, Agni (fire) Astra, and even from animals and plants. These astras’ are disguised as everyday objects that grant those who wield them the power of that element and they become the members of Brahmansh.

Above all, there’s the most powerful Astra, Brahmastra, a supernatural celestial weapon that’s said to be able to destroy the universe, which was broken into three pieces to save it from the dark forces. But the dark forces have been relentlessly searching for it and now they are getting closer to their goal.

The film is set against the background of Dussehra and Diwali, which is particularly celebrated for the victory of good over evil. This forms the base plot of the story, our male lead Shiva is a good-hearted DJ who doesn’t get hurt by fire but even he doesn’t know why. He sees a girl at the Dussehra celebration and instantly falls in love.

As nobody could stop fate, he meets the girl Isha again and sparks fly for both of them. But who would know that his meet-cute would end up changing the complete course of his life, as the powers that reside in him are finally coming to the surface. He is also haunted by some visions and he must find out the reason behind them.

But as what’s meant to be will always find a way, Isha holds Shiva’s hand tightly and together they both get on the magical journey of love, light, fire and self-discovery with lurking dark dangers following them. In a general sense, the film wants to show how love and goodness will always win over dark and evil energies, no matter how powerful or universally destructive they might be.

The whole concept of Astraverse is definitely well planned and doesn’t leave you feeling confused or boggle your mind with many theories or questions. The film reveals information in a well-paced manner, without feeling too rushed or dragging for long. The action sequences are spectacular to watch and hype up the audience as well.

And like many films that have tried their hand at visual effects and animation and terribly failed, Brahmāstra: Part One – Shiva conquers these failed attempts and brings something amazing to the Indian cinema which could be on par with the big Hollywood films. They might not win over it completely but definitely raise the bar for Indian cinema.

Summing Up: Brahmastra Part One Shiva

The film definitely brings something fresh and visually spectacular to the Indian screens. However, it also overpowers the other elements of the film like the acting. The film is a core love story but they breeze through it quickly without building up the love story part which feels a bit rushed and forced.

Creators did try to add some light moments in the scenes with some one-liners and abrupt dialogues but they ended up looking bad and awkward for a superhero film. It is to note that the film is made for 3D viewing primarily, it might not feel as grand on normal screens. The film is said to be a trilogy and the creators are testing the waters with its first part.

But looking at the houseful theatres and cheers throughout the film, they should get started on the next parts as well, as the public will be demanding more. Also, be ready for some surprising cameos that steal the show.

Brahmastra Part One Shiva is currently available in theatres in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, Kannada and Malayalam.
